Id like to know if the PH entered into any agreements as a condition for it to join ICC. It was noted in several media that other countries like the US are not members of ICC so it seems to imply that it would have been detrimental to the interests of more powerful countries. What did the PH gain/stand to gain by being a member of the ICC?
To clarify my question, were there any agreements outside the ICC itself that was offered to PH and was likewise accepted as an exchange for it to join the ICC? (Trade agreements etc.)
